Block
#8,866,559
159w
31 txs4,721,806 confs
Transactions
31
Total Output
₳9,629,265.94
$1.45M
Fees
₳10.54
Size
73.25 KB
75,011 bytes
Details
Hash
4c29fafda23a53d5b7a15b1d4c6fc3900399edac036cfa771af44f6f7ece47f0
Epoch / Slot
Epoch 416 · slot 94,431,638 · epoch-slot 82,838
Timestamp
159w · Mon, 05 Jun 2023 20:45:29 GMT
Block producer
VRF key
vrf_vk1d…hqszrgpv
Op cert
3ee32f75…b951ee55
Op cert counter
13
Transactions in block30